Episode 4 of Taylor Swift: The End of an Era is out today, and yes, she finally goes there. Breakups. Travis Kelce. And the surprise matchmaker who got them talking. The episode pulls a lot of threads together into one story about how her last few years cracked her open, how the tour held her together, and why this relationship works without colliding with the rest of her life.

Disney+ dropped Episodes 3 and 4 today (December 19, 2025), and this one is the most candid she has been about that stretch of time. It connects the heartbreaks, the people who keep the show running, and Kelce into a single arc instead of scattered tabloid headlines.

The hardest songs came first

Episode 4 opens with Taylor in the studio tracking songs from The Tortured Poets Department, and she spells it out: that album came out of the roughest, most emotionally scrambled period she has ever had. She does not say names on camera, but she confirms two breakups during the first half of the Eras Tour — which, in plain English, is the Joe Alwyn and Matty Healy timeline.

She talks about feeling flattened by fame and by relationships, like people were reacting to the brand more than the person. What kept her upright was the show. The tour gave her routine, purpose, and something to pour it all into.

"Men will let you down. The Eras Tour never will."

New Orleans: two breakup songs, one mom misunderstanding

Cut to New Orleans, where Taylor is walking her mom through the acoustic set: a mashup of 'Welcome to New York' and 'Hits Different.' Her mom hears the plan and — thinking they are talking about Kelce — asks who they mean right now. 'Travis Kelce, your boyfriend,' comes the clarification. Taylor gently corrects the premise: these are breakup songs.

She explains the story those songs tell: someone gets wrecked, cannot move on, and starts over in a big city to find purpose again. She also makes a point to her mom that she does not need convincing to be with someone who is actually good for her. You can hear the subtext. It is not subtle.

About that matchmaker reveal

The episode finally confirms what the internet has been guessing around: Andrea Swift is the one who pushed this thing forward. After Travis Kelce showed up to an Eras stop and tried to hand off a friendship bracelet with his number, Andrea did some quiet recon. She saw the headlines, called her cousin Robin (the family Chiefs expert), and asked for the read.

The feedback was exactly what a mom wants to hear: he is legitimately nice and adores his mother. Andrea liked that his approach brought something from Taylor's world back to her — a small, thoughtful gesture instead of some slick move. That was enough to nudge Taylor to meet him.

Why Kelce fits when others did not

Taylor is pretty frank about why past relationships struggled: the tour was always a conflict she could not shrink. With Kelce, the rhythms line up instead of grinding gears. Both of them spend three and a half hours lighting up NFL stadiums. Both have been chasing a singular thing since they were kids. That shared pace matters.

"I do not think I ever thought I would meet a guy who had that same trajectory. And with this person in my life, I have realized you can let the two passions coexist — they actually fuel each other."

Indy ends the episode on a warm note

The episode closes in Indianapolis with acoustic mashups, a backstage hello with Kelce, and a moment where Taylor clocks how many people in the crowd are wearing his jersey number. She smiles at how quickly her fans embraced him — because, as she puts it, he is just plain lovable.

Spotlight on the team: Sabrina Carpenter and a dancer getting his shot

The doc also spends time with the people around her. Sabrina Carpenter pops in for the New Orleans shows; they rehearse and then rip through three songs together. And there is a backstage arc that is very specific in the best way: dancer Whyley asks to jump into the '...Ready For It?' number, which is traditionally an all-women segment. He talks about being told to tone it down earlier in his career. On this tour, the rulebook is different.

Taylor says the show has no restrictions, he squeezes into Amanda's costume (literally), she signs off, and he performs the number in New Orleans. It is a small moment that says a lot about how this camp operates.
